Roles & Responsibilities
- Assess patients quickly and accurately, prioritizing care based on acuity
- Provide advanced life support interventions including airway management and medication administration
- Collaborate closely with the ED team to hand off patients safely and thoroughly
- Document patient care clearly, concisely, and in compliance with hospital policies
- Operate and maintain emergency equipment and supplies to ensure readiness
- Communicate compassionately with patients and families during stressful moments
- Participate in training, drills, and quality improvement efforts to elevate team performance
Qualifications
- Current Paramedic license or certification (state or National Registry) required
- Basic Life Support (BLS) required; Advanced certifications such as ACLS preferred
- Valid driver license and ability to meet hospital credentialing requirements
- Comfort working in a fast-paced emergency environment and making quick decisions
- Clean background check and up to date immunizations per facility policy
Education
- Paramedic certificate or diploma from an accredited program
- High school diploma or GED required; additional college coursework or degree preferred
Knowledge & Skills
- Strong emergency assessment and triage skills
- Proficiency with advanced airway techniques and cardiac monitoring
- Medication administration and IV therapy experience
- Clear, calm communication with patients, families, and multidisciplinary teams
- Competence with electronic patient care documentation
- Ability to remain organized and decisive under pressure
